The annual press ball organised by the Norwich Evening News on Friday night raised £13,200 for the city's pioneering SOS bus, the project which helps thousands of vulnerable revellers during their city centre nights out. Evening News editor David Bourn said: "The ball was a huge success and I am very proud the paper has managed to raise so much money for this life-saving and very worthwhile cause."
